New planes for new times
Re the new Boeing Poseidon aircraft, yes, the total cost of $2.3 billion is a lot but this includes spares, training and the removal of the facilities from Whenuapai to establishing a new base in Ohakea. The old aircraft are so old they cannot be upgraded any more and the Poseidons appear to be the most suitable for our needs.
New Zealand needs a maritme surveillance capability, as it has had for many years, and the fact these new planes have more offensive capabilities is surely a recognition that we live in changing times.
Let us not forget history has a way of repeating itself, so buy the planes and be prepared.
